In the annals of human innovation, few domains have undergone as profound a transformation as computing. Since its inception, the computing realm has morphed from rudimentary mechanical devices to sophisticated systems that wield the formidable power to analyze vast datasets, automate mundane tasks, and even facilitate artificial intelligence. This metamorphosis is not merely a tale of technical advancement; it is a narrative woven into the fabric of societal evolution, significantly altering how we communicate, work, and live.
The origins of computing trace back to the ancient abacus, an ingenious tool that laid the groundwork for future numerical manipulation. However, the first conceptual leap towards modern computing emerged with the development of the mechanical calculator in the 17th century, primarily orchestrated by the likes of Blaise Pascal and Gottfried Wilhelm Leibniz. Their pioneering efforts introduced the notion of automating arithmetic processes, setting the stage for subsequent innovations that would transpire.
The dawn of the 20th century witnessed the emergence of electromechanical computers, which utilized a symbiosis of electrical circuits and mechanical components. The most notable of these was the Z3, crafted by Konrad Zuse in 1941, which represented a watershed moment in computing history as it was the first programmable computer. This invention heralded the transition from mere calculations to the programmable logic that would lay the foundation for modern software development.
The second half of the 20th century unfolded with unimaginable fervor, marked by the inception of the transistor in 1947 and the subsequent invention of the integrated circuit. These breakthroughs facilitated dramatic advances in computational speed while simultaneously reducing the size of computing devices. This period also birthed the first generation of computers, typified by the colossal ENIAC, which demanded as much space as a large room but could perform calculations at astonishing speeds for its time.
As we ventured into the 1970s and 1980s, the computing landscape began to democratize through the advent of personal computers. Visionaries like Steve Jobs and Bill Gates revolutionized the concept of computing by placing powerful tools into the hands of the average person. The proliferation of the microprocessor not only shrank computing devices but also made them accessible, setting the stage for a digital revolution that would permeate every aspect of life. The user-friendly interfaces that they implemented transformed computing from an esoteric field into an essential everyday tool.
Moreover, the internet, born from military research, evolved into a global communication juggernaut, radically enhancing connectivity. This seminal shift not only changed how we exchange information but catalyzed new industries and stimulated innovation at an unprecedented scale. Today, computing is not confined to traditional devices; it has extended into realms such as cloud computing, artificial intelligence, and big data analytics, each contributing to a more interconnected and efficient world.
In contemporary society, computing is the backbone of myriad applications, from simple household tasks to complex scientific simulations. The capacious power of data analytics has invigorated sectors such as healthcare, finance, and education, allowing for informed decision-making and strategic planning. For instance, predictive algorithms employed in medical diagnostics can analyze patient data and assist healthcare professionals in delivering personalized treatment plans, demonstrating the tangible benefits of computing.
As we peer into the future, one cannot help but ponder the ethical and societal ramifications of continued advancements in computing. The rise of artificial intelligence raises profound questions about autonomy, privacy, and the nature of work. Responsibility lies not only in technological innovation but also in our ability to navigate the ethical minefields it presents. It is essential to engage in thoughtful discourse about the implications of these technologies to ensure that they serve humanity efficiently and ethically.
In conclusion, computing stands as a testament to human ingenuity, reshaping our world in ways once deemed implausible. As this journey continues, it invites us all to explore and engage with an endless stream of possibilities. For further insights into this transformative field, feel free to explore this informative resource, which delves deeper into the nuances and future projections of computing trends. The future is indeed bright, and it is only through understanding and embracing these changes that we can shape a better tomorrow.